Enhance Your WordPress Site: Best SEO Plugins for Ranking Higher in 2024

Introduction

In today's competitive digital landscape, having a well-optimized website is crucial for improving search engine rankings, attracting visitors, and ultimately growing your online presence. With over 40% of websites globally running on WordPress, it’s no surprise that the platform offers a range of SEO plugins designed to boost your site's performance and visibility. SEO plugins simplify the technical aspects of optimization, enabling you to focus on creating high-quality content while ensuring your site ranks higher on search engines like Google.

In this guide, we’ll explore the best SEO plugins for WordPress in 2024, focusing on their features, benefits, and how they can enhance your site’s SEO strategy. From on-page analysis to schema markup, these plugins will help you stay ahead of the competition.

Let’s start with the industry favorite: Yoast SEO.

Essential SEO Plugins for On-Page Optimization

1. Yoast SEO

Yoast SEO continues to be one of the most popular and comprehensive SEO plugins for WordPress. Known for its user-friendly interface and powerful features, it provides everything you need to optimize your content and website structure for search engines.

  • On-Page Analysis: Yoast SEO offers real-time feedback as you create content, helping you optimize keywords, internal links, and meta descriptions. It highlights areas where you can improve your SEO and readability, making it easier to optimize for both search engines and users.

  • XML Sitemap Creation: Yoast SEO automatically generates XML sitemaps, which are crucial for helping search engines index your website more efficiently. These sitemaps ensure that your content is discoverable by search engines and helps improve your site’s crawlability.

  • Snippet Preview: One of Yoast’s standout features is the snippet preview tool, which shows how your post or page will appear in search results. It allows you to optimize your meta title, URL, and meta description, ensuring they are enticing and relevant for search engine users.

Yoast SEO is an all-in-one SEO solution that’s perfect for users of all levels, from beginners to advanced marketers. Its frequent updates and thorough support ensure that your site remains aligned with the latest SEO best practices.


2. Rank Math

Rank Math has quickly risen to popularity due to its feature-rich, easy-to-use interface. It’s designed to provide a complete SEO solution, helping you manage everything from on-page SEO to integrating your site with Google Search Console.

  • Setup Wizard: Rank Math’s setup wizard simplifies the initial configuration process, guiding you through the necessary steps to optimize your site. Whether you’re an SEO novice or expert, Rank Math makes it easy to start optimizing your site right away.

  • Advanced SEO Analysis: This plugin offers an in-depth SEO performance analysis, providing insights into how your pages and posts are optimized. It breaks down critical metrics, offering detailed recommendations to improve your on-page SEO.

  • Google Search Console Integration: Rank Math allows you to connect your site directly to Google Search Console, giving you immediate access to valuable insights and data about how your site is performing in search results.

Rank Math’s combination of powerful features and ease of use makes it an excellent alternative to Yoast SEO. Its deep integration with Google’s tools also provides additional functionality that many SEO experts find invaluable.


3. All in One SEO (AIOSEO)

All in One SEO (AIOSEO) has long been a popular choice for WordPress users looking for a robust SEO plugin. It’s particularly known for its ease of use and ability to handle both on-page and technical SEO needs.

  • SEO Audit Checklist: AIOSEO provides a comprehensive SEO audit checklist that evaluates your site’s SEO performance and suggests actionable improvements. This feature is invaluable for identifying weaknesses in your strategy and making necessary adjustments.

  • Local SEO Features: For businesses that rely on local search traffic, AIOSEO offers local SEO optimization features, helping your site appear in relevant local search results. This is especially important for brick-and-mortar businesses aiming to attract local customers.

  • Social Media Integration: AIOSEO helps optimize your content for sharing across social media platforms by allowing you to control how your posts appear when shared. This feature enhances visibility on platforms like Facebook and Twitter, ensuring your content is SEO-optimized even outside search engines.

AIOSEO is a versatile tool that caters to both beginners and advanced users, making it a strong contender for those looking to boost their SEO efforts with minimal setup.


4. SEOPress

SEOPress is a lightweight SEO plugin that offers a range of features without bogging down your website with unnecessary tools or ads. It’s a great option for users who want to focus on performance while still accessing powerful SEO features.

  • No Ads: SEOPress provides a clean, ad-free interface, making it a favorite among users who want a distraction-free experience. The streamlined dashboard helps you stay focused on optimizing your content.

  • Content Analysis: The plugin offers an intuitive content analysis feature that checks your posts and pages for SEO optimization, keyword placement, and readability. This ensures that your content is fully optimized before you hit publish.

  • Schema Markup Support: SEOPress also supports schema markup, allowing you to enhance your search engine results with rich snippets. Rich snippets provide additional information in search results, improving your click-through rate and visibility.

SEOPress is ideal for those who prefer a minimalist, performance-focused plugin without sacrificing essential SEO tools.

5. Ahrefs SEO

Ahrefs SEO is renowned for its powerful backlink analysis capabilities and comprehensive suite of SEO tools. While it’s a paid tool, Ahrefs offers a WordPress plugin that integrates with your site, providing insights to help you optimize your off-page SEO strategy.

  • Backlink Analysis: Ahrefs’ standout feature is its ability to analyze your backlink profile in great detail. Backlinks remain a critical ranking factor in SEO, and Ahrefs helps you track who is linking to your site, the quality of those links, and whether they are helping or hurting your rankings.

  • Keyword Research Tools: Ahrefs helps you identify high-potential keywords based on competition, search volume, and relevance to your niche. This feature allows you to target the most valuable keywords for your site, increasing your chances of ranking higher in search results.

  • Content Explorer: With Ahrefs’ Content Explorer, you can analyze the top-performing content in your industry. This tool provides insights into what type of content attracts backlinks and ranks well, helping you refine your content strategy.

Ahrefs SEO is a must-have plugin for businesses that rely heavily on backlinks and off-page SEO strategies. Its detailed reports and data-driven insights provide a competitive edge, especially in highly competitive niches.


a modern WordPress website dashboard on a laptop, showcasing SEO plugin tools such as Yoast SEO, Rank Math, and WP Rocket, with various performance optimization stats and real-time SEO analysis on screen.


6. Semrush SEO Writing Assistant

Semrush is a well-known digital marketing tool, and its SEO Writing Assistant plugin for WordPress is a game-changer for content creators. It provides real-time recommendations to help you optimize your content for SEO based on the latest ranking factors.

  • Real-Time Content Optimization: The SEO Writing Assistant analyzes your content in real-time, providing recommendations on keyword usage, readability, tone, and SEO-friendliness. It helps you tailor your content to rank higher by aligning with Google’s current algorithm preferences.

  • Plagiarism Checker: Original content is a crucial aspect of SEO, and Semrush’s plugin includes a plagiarism checker to ensure that your content is unique and not duplicated from other sources. This feature helps you avoid penalties for duplicate content, which can severely impact your rankings.

  • SEO Content Templates: The plugin generates SEO content templates based on your target keyword. These templates provide a structured framework to create optimized content, helping you hit the right balance between quality and SEO-friendliness.

Semrush’s plugin is ideal for bloggers, content marketers, and SEO professionals looking to enhance their content strategy while ensuring it meets search engine requirements. Its combination of content analysis and keyword optimization makes it an invaluable tool for improving your SEO performance.


7. Google Search Console Integration

While not a traditional plugin, integrating Google Search Console with your WordPress site is essential for monitoring your website’s performance in search results. Google Search Console is a free tool that provides a wealth of data on how Google crawls and indexes your site.

  • Performance Monitoring: Google Search Console helps you track keyword rankings, click-through rates (CTR), and site impressions. By analyzing this data, you can adjust your SEO strategy to target high-performing keywords and improve your rankings.

  • Crawl Error Alerts: One of the most valuable features of Google Search Console is its ability to notify you of crawl errors or issues that could affect your site’s indexing. This includes broken links, server errors, and missing pages—issues that can negatively impact your SEO if left unresolved.

  • Sitemap Submission: You can submit your XML sitemaps directly to Google Search Console, ensuring that Google can efficiently crawl and index all the pages on your website.

Integrating Google Search Console with your WordPress site is a must for tracking your site’s performance in search results. Its detailed insights and error notifications allow you to proactively address SEO issues and ensure your site is optimized for Google’s crawlers.


8. WP Rocket

WP Rocket is primarily a caching plugin, but it plays a crucial role in SEO by improving your site’s loading speed—a significant ranking factor. In 2024, page speed continues to be critical for both user experience and SEO performance.

  • Page Caching: WP Rocket reduces your website’s load times by caching your pages and serving static versions of your content. This speeds up page delivery to visitors and improves your overall SEO score, as faster sites are more likely to rank higher in search results.

  • Minification of CSS and JavaScript: The plugin also minifies CSS and JavaScript files, which reduces their size and improves page loading times. This optimization helps your site load faster, especially on mobile devices, where speed is critical for user experience.

  • Lazy Loading: WP Rocket includes a lazy loading feature, which defers the loading of images until they are visible on the user’s screen. This not only speeds up initial page load times but also enhances the user experience by prioritizing visible content.

With Core Web Vitals playing an increasingly important role in SEO rankings, WP Rocket is essential for improving your site’s performance, reducing bounce rates, and ensuring faster page load times.


9. Schema Pro

Schema Pro is a plugin designed to implement schema markup on your WordPress site with ease. Schema markup helps search engines understand your content better and enhances the way your site appears in search results through rich snippets.

  • Rich Snippets Support: Schema Pro makes it easy to add rich snippets to your site’s pages and posts. Rich snippets enhance your visibility in search results by displaying additional information, such as star ratings, product prices, and FAQs.

  • Pre-built Schema Types: Schema Pro offers pre-built schema types for common content, such as articles, reviews, events, and local businesses. This makes it easy to apply structured data without needing to write any code.

  • Custom Schema Markup: For advanced users, Schema Pro allows you to create custom schema markup tailored to your content. This flexibility ensures that all your site’s content is optimized for rich snippets, giving you an edge in search visibility.

By adding structured data to your site, Schema Pro helps you stand out in search results and attract more clicks through enhanced visibility. Rich snippets can significantly improve your click-through rate (CTR), which in turn boosts your SEO rankings.


10. DiagnoSEO

A newer addition to the SEO plugin ecosystem, DiagnoSEO focuses on lightweight yet effective optimization tools that help you fine-tune your content and SEO strategy.

  • Content Analyzer Checkpoints: DiagnoSEO provides a content analyzer that highlights key checkpoints for SEO, such as keyword placement, readability, and internal linking. It helps ensure that your content is fully optimized before publishing.

  • AI Integration: The plugin uses AI-driven analysis to generate suggestions for improving your content, including recommendations for meta descriptions, keyword usage, and header tags. It streamlines the optimization process by providing actionable insights directly in the WordPress editor.

  • SEO Metadata Generation: DiagnoSEO also features AI-based metadata generation, which creates optimized meta titles and descriptions based on your content. This is particularly useful for improving your site’s appearance in search results.

DiagnoSEO is a great choice for users who want a lightweight, AI-driven plugin to help with everyday SEO tasks. Its content optimization tools and metadata generation make it easy to fine-tune your site’s SEO without adding unnecessary complexity.

11. Long-Term SEO Strategy: Key Takeaways

Having the right SEO plugins installed on your WordPress site is just one part of the equation. To maintain long-term SEO success in 2024 and beyond, you need to implement consistent strategies that align with both user experience and search engine guidelines. Here are some key takeaways to keep your site ranking high:

Regular Content Updates and Optimization

Search engines favor websites that consistently provide fresh and relevant content. Updating your existing content to reflect new information or changing search trends can help maintain your rankings.

  • Content Audit: Use tools like Rank Math or Yoast SEO to perform regular content audits. Update outdated blog posts, refresh meta descriptions, and ensure that internal linking is optimized.

  • Long-Form Content: Google rewards websites that offer in-depth, informative content. Regularly create long-form content targeting specific keywords and questions your audience is searching for.

Focus on Core Web Vitals and Site Speed

As search engines like Google place more importance on user experience metrics, optimizing for Core Web Vitals is crucial. Plugins like WP Rocket are essential for improving page load speed, reducing server response times, and enhancing overall performance.

  • Mobile Optimization: Ensure that your site is fully optimized for mobile devices. Tools like Google Search Console can help you track mobile performance and fix any mobile usability issues that may arise.

  • Image Compression: Use image optimization plugins to compress large images without losing quality. Faster load times translate to better user experience, which helps with SEO.

Leverage Structured Data

Using schema markup helps search engines better understand your content, improving how it is displayed in search results through rich snippets. Plugins like Schema Pro make it easy to add structured data to your site.

  • Rich Snippets: Implement schema markup to display star ratings, FAQs, product details, and more. This improves your visibility in search results and encourages more clicks from users.

  • Enhanced Search Appearance: Use tools like SEOPress to ensure your meta tags, titles, and descriptions are optimized and display correctly in search results.


12. Bonus Plugins for Enhanced SEO Performance

While we’ve already covered some of the best SEO plugins, there are a few additional tools that can offer unique features to further boost your site’s search engine performance. These plugins provide specialized SEO functionalities, such as keyword rank tracking, image SEO, and content optimization.

Broken Link Checker

Broken Link Checker is a simple yet effective plugin that scans your WordPress site for broken links and missing images. Broken links not only frustrate users but also negatively impact your SEO rankings, as search engines consider them a sign of poor user experience.

  • Automatic Scans: The plugin scans your entire website for broken links, helping you fix them before they harm your rankings.

  • SEO Impact: Regularly checking and fixing broken links keeps your site user-friendly and prevents your rankings from being penalized by search engines.

Redirection

Redirection is a powerful plugin that helps you manage 301 redirects and track 404 errors, ensuring that users and search engines can always find the correct content on your site.

  • 301 Redirect Management: Easily manage 301 redirects to ensure that visitors and search engine bots are directed to the correct pages. This is particularly important when updating old content or moving pages.

  • 404 Error Tracking: The plugin logs 404 errors and alerts you when a page is missing, allowing you to create redirects and ensure no dead ends on your site.

By using Redirection, you can maintain clean site navigation and ensure a smooth user experience, which will contribute positively to your SEO rankings.

Smush

Smush is an image optimization plugin that automatically compresses and optimizes your images, helping to improve page load times—a critical factor in SEO.

  • Image Compression: Smush compresses images without sacrificing quality, ensuring that your site loads quickly even with high-resolution images.

  • Lazy Loading: The plugin also offers lazy loading, which defers the loading of images until the user scrolls to them. This feature enhances the initial load time of your pages.

Smush is essential for websites that rely heavily on visuals, such as blogs or eCommerce stores. By optimizing images, you ensure faster loading speeds, better user experience, and improved SEO performance.


13. Implementing SEO Best Practices in 2024

As SEO continues to evolve, it’s essential to stay ahead of trends and adapt your strategy accordingly. The plugins and tools we've discussed throughout this guide provide a solid foundation for optimizing your WordPress site, but here are some SEO best practices to keep in mind for 2024:

Focus on User Intent

Google’s algorithms are becoming increasingly sophisticated in understanding user intent. To stay competitive, ensure that your content aligns with what users are actually searching for.

  • Keyword Research: Use tools like Ahrefs or Semrush to perform in-depth keyword research, identifying high-intent keywords that match the search queries of your target audience.

  • Content Alignment: Ensure that your content addresses the specific questions and needs of your audience. Avoid keyword stuffing and instead focus on creating helpful, engaging, and informative content.

Optimize for Voice Search

With the rise of voice search and smart assistants, optimizing your content for voice search queries is becoming increasingly important. Voice searches are often longer and more conversational, so focus on answering questions directly in your content.

  • Long-Tail Keywords: Include long-tail keywords and natural language phrases that are more likely to be used in voice search queries.

  • Featured Snippets: Optimize your content for featured snippets, which are often used by Google to answer voice search queries. Structured data and clear, concise answers can help you land these coveted spots.

Keep Up with Algorithm Updates

Google frequently updates its algorithms, and staying informed about these changes is crucial for maintaining your SEO rankings.

  • SEO Blogs: Follow reputable SEO blogs like Search Engine Journal, Moz, or Ahrefs Blog to stay updated on algorithm changes and new SEO strategies.

  • Google Search Console: Regularly monitor your site’s performance in Google Search Console to identify any changes in traffic or rankings after algorithm updates.


a modern WordPress website open on a laptop, focusing on SEO optimization tools with plugins like Yoast SEO and WP Rocket displayed.


Conclusion: Enhance Your WordPress Site for 2024 and Beyond

Incorporating the right SEO plugins into your WordPress site is essential for improving search engine rankings, driving organic traffic, and maintaining long-term success. By using tools like Yoast SEO, Rank Math, Ahrefs, and Schema Pro, you can optimize every aspect of your website—from on-page content and site speed to off-page backlinks and technical SEO.

To summarize, here’s a quick recap of the top SEO plugins:

  1. Yoast SEO – Comprehensive on-page SEO and content analysis.

  2. Rank Math – Powerful SEO analysis with Google Search Console integration.

  3. All in One SEO (AIOSEO) – Versatile plugin with local SEO features and social media optimization.

  4. SEOPress – Lightweight plugin with schema markup support and no ads.

  5. Ahrefs – Industry-leading backlink analysis and content research.

  6. Semrush SEO Writing Assistant – Real-time content recommendations for SEO optimization.

  7. Google Search Console – Essential performance monitoring and crawl error tracking.

  8. WP Rocket – Page caching and performance optimization for faster load times.

  9. Schema Pro – Easy implementation of schema markup for rich snippets.

  10. DiagnoSEO – Lightweight AI-powered plugin for metadata generation and content analysis.

By choosing the right combination of these plugins and adhering to SEO best practices, you can significantly enhance your WordPress site’s performance and achieve higher rankings in 2024. Now is the time to start optimizing—implement these tools, stay informed about SEO trends, and watch your website soar in search engine rankings.

Popular

Discover how JavaScript transforms static pages into dynamic, engaging web experiences. Learn innovative solutions and best practices from The Code Catalyst to optimize performance, enhance security, ...
Learn how to enhance your website's user experience with custom jQuery scripts. Discover the key features of jQuery, dynamic content loading, form validation, interactive elements, and advanced techni...
Discover the best WordPress plugins and add-ons to enhance your site's performance, security, SEO, and user experience. From caching and security to form builders and analytics, learn how to optimize ...
Dive into the world of Java development with our detailed guide on building a location tracking app. Learn the essentials, follow our step-by-step instructions, and create a powerful app like Number T...
Discover expert tips to enhance your web development skills with JavaScript, jQuery, and WordPress plugins. Learn advanced techniques in DOM manipulation, asynchronous programming, efficient plugin de...